RiverArts Hosts Trip to Nightscape –  October 13

October 10, 2016 by RiverArts

Share

Experience the wonder of at Longwood Gardens after dark.   This nighttime adventure transforms the landscape into a magical garden through light, movement, color, and original music. Installations include the Mediterranean Garden and Waterlily Display.

Join RiverArts for a trip to Longwood Gardens and Nightscape on Thursday, October 13.  Seating is limited.  Ticket cost of $75, ($65 RiverArts members), includes bus and ticket to Nightscape. Bus will depart Chestertown at 2 pm, arriving at Longwood in time to stroll the gardens before dusk and dine prior to the start of Nightscape.  There are a variety of dining options, from a full service, reservations only restaurant to a beer garden with live music.
